Output 43b2b80841f74ec140960bfe4d562d10050f78317b720db04c5ec151daeaa1d5:50
- value
- 17520475
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d72916be04bd1d814ef8427223e712b63aa6436a OP_EQUAL
- address
- 3MJgRgxXHg16tiGu7Fgs7W6AQtCuXh7sfK
- transaction
- 43b2b80841f74ec140960bfe4d562d10050f78317b720db04c5ec151daeaa1d5
- spent
- true